    Finding a Groomer that could work with our male Keeshond has been difficult to say the least. We…read morefound one, Chris, at the store in Memphis but he transferred to Oxford...lucky Oxford...and since then it's been aweful. One groomer cut Dakota's dew claw off at the knuckle and he was in pain for weeks after so he DID NOT want to be brushed, bathed or anything but snuggled for months. Finally our beautiful big man was turning into one big raggedy looking Kees. We were doing the best we could to bathe and brush him but it's just not the same as a good 5 hours at a professional groomers. Then we found Petco, the new one that opened in Olive Branch just recently, and I haven't seen him look this wonderful in a very long time. Not only did they do a beautiful job on him and my other Kees, Tolly, but Dakota came back in high spirits, and not cowering and shivering like the last groomer. After bathing and drying the groomer took extra care brushing out all the undercoat until their coats were gleaming and soft...anyone who has a dog with two coats dreads this time of the year when they begin to molt, underfur drifts around the house like warm fuzzy snowballs and you'll just finish vacuuming to find little keesie tumbleweeds following you...and I swear they're laughing...I sincerely hope they don't change staff because as of this experience we will continue to happily bring our two beautiful Kees to Petco in Olive Branch for grooming!

    My pup got spayed here. Her recovery was great. No complaints on that…read more Weeks later I brought her in to get medication for vomiting and the vet noted that down- all good, gave us the medicine. I also mentioned she had been shaking her head a lot. So he told me they could clean out her ears. I accepted and he told me someone else would come in to take her to the back and clean her ears. But while we were in the waiting room, I noticed some small bumps on her skin , so I brought that up to the male vet(we are already there- might as well) he completely ignored me and said he doesn't feel anything on her. Mind you, she has a bunch of curly fur so you can't just pet her and feel it. You have to separate her fur and actually feel for her skin. So whatever. I ignored it bc she wasn't itching it or licking it. It was just a small red bump. Moments go by and I'm feeling around her paw and I noticed a more concerning bump/lump..idk. I called for another staff member that was around, and I told HER. She starts feeling around her paw and she notices the bump I am talking about. This was easier to find bc I told her she had got gum stuck in her paw a couple days ago and I used coconut oil to massage it out and there was slightly less fur around that area. She called in another girl. Not sure if she's a vet or not, but they shaved down that area to get a better look and they basically just said it was probably scabbed. Maybe the coconut oil irritated her skin. Ok Cool. They put some cream on her and told me to come back if it got worse. Saying allll that to say, please advocate for your fur babies These visits arnt free. Don't let them brush off your concerns.
